China guangdong shenzhen Ali cloud
Websites on 8.129.62.91
- Domain names that have been bound:
- 2022-11-25-----2023-05-11vn.huolala.cn
- 2020-11-24-----2023-05-06hll-tms.huolala.cn
- 2021-01-17-----2022-03-11vendors-static.huolala.cn
- 2022-02-19-----2022-02-26qapi.huolala.cn
- 2021-11-25-----2021-11-25siku-api.huolala.cn
- 2020-11-28-----2021-10-12act.huolala.cn
- 2021-09-08-----2021-10-12dep.huolala.cn
- 2021-09-16-----2021-09-16ops2.huolala.cn
- 2020-11-04-----2021-09-10mktapi.huolala.cn
- 2021-09-10-----2021-09-10skyeye.huolala.cn
- 2021-04-22-----2021-04-22hestia.huolala.cn
- website server lookup history
- www.xnxx.com
- kan8tv.com
- www.vidz.com
- www.bokep.com
- top1.xnxx.com
- xnxx.com
- httpwww.3344.com
- www.dmxs.org
- down1.5156edu.com
- 79456.com
- www.91p91.com
- www.5x87.com
- wwwmissav.com
- by1191.com
- www.8888.vip
- www.streamsex.com
- yy58888.com
- ipv6.stboy.net
- 8899.com
- https.netflav.com
- hosting ip address lookup history
- 104.18.59.112
- 183.201.75.3
- 103.235.174.78
- 108.139.1.84
- 111.132.1.107
- 104.25.23.28
- 103.194.186.235
- 23.80.10.40
- 104.18.0.125
- 23.219.32.54
- 185.88.181.57
- 104.24.117.123
- 111.90.150.204
- 175.29.218.194
- 150.138.232.43
- 23.7.220.96
- 54.192.35.13
- 3.109.34.70
- 112.74.23.5
- 8.218.238.42